Freshly released documents connected to convicted sex offender Jeffrey Epstein have drawn renewed attention to Indian-American author and wellness figure Deepak Chopra. The records, accessed by CNN, are part of the Epstein archive maintained by the United States Department of Justice and reveal extensive communication between Chopra and Epstein years after Epstein’s 2008 conviction.

Messages Continued Years After Conviction

According to the documents, Chopra and Epstein remained in regular contact between 2016 and 2019, exchanging hundreds of messages. Some of these communications reportedly included remarks described as lewd and sexist in nature, raising questions about the tone and context of their interaction during a period when Epstein was already a convicted offender.

Quotes From Messages Raise Eyebrows

The files cite multiple messages in which Chopra allegedly encouraged Epstein to bring “girls” along on trips and events. In one message, Chopra wrote, “Your girls would love it, as would you.” On another occasion, while discussing a workshop in Switzerland, he again suggested Epstein bring his “girls.”

The correspondence also included philosophical exchanges. Chopra wrote, “God is a construct. Cute girls are real.” Epstein responded, “When the girls say, oh my god…?” Chopra then replied, “Yes, that’s divine tran=cendence”.

Financial and Professional Links Mentioned

Beyond personal conversations, the documents also point to financial and professional overlap. Chopra and his associate Poonacha Machaiah reportedly sought Epstein’s input on the wellness app Jiyo. Records show that in 2017, Chopra received a $50,000 cheque from “Gratitude America,” a foundation linked to Epstein.

Messages During Public Backlash

The files indicate that during a period when Epstein was under intense public scrutiny, Chopra appeared to offer advice and reassurance. In one message, he wrote, “Sorry, I am not concerned about that,” and suggested Epstein should “Stay silent. Meditate.”

Family Introduction Also Referenced

The correspondence further mentions Chopra introducing his son-in-law to Epstein, telling him, “You might enjoy meeting him,” followed by the remark “(can’t talk about girls).” The documents do not clarify whether such a meeting ever took place.

Chopra’s Public Response

Earlier this month, Chopra addressed his past association with Epstein in a post on X. He stated, “I am deeply saddened by the suffering of the victims in this case, and I unequivocally condemn abuse and exploitation in all forms.”

He added, “I want to be clear: I was never involved in, nor did I participate in, any criminal or exploitative conduct. Any contact I had was limited and unrelated to abusive activity. Some past email exchanges have surfaced that reflect poor judgement in tone. I regret that and understand how they read today, given what was publicly known at the time.”

Chopra concluded by saying, “My focus remains on supporting accountability, prevention, and efforts that protect and support survivors.”
